Resumo
This study presents the Matlab simulation of PID, type-1 and interval type-2 fuzzy logic controllers (FLC) applied to an Electromagnetic Force Compensation (EMFC) load cell, implemented in the Matlab/Simulink environment. A massspring-damper mechanical model is employed to represent system dynamics. The performance of the fuzzy controllers is compared to that of a conventional PID controller. Stability characteristics and frequency response are also investigated. FLCs yield superior performance in EMFC load cell applications when compared to classical PID control.
